Exactly How Cold Laser Therapy Works
To recognize exactly how cold laser treatment works, you require to realize the essential concepts of exactly how light energy interacts with organic tissues. Cold laser treatment, also referred to as low-level laser therapy (LLLT), uses certain wavelengths of light to permeate the skin and target hidden tissues. Unlike facial rejuvenation westport utilized in surgeries, cold lasers give off low degrees of light that do not generate warmth or cause damage to the cells.
When these gentle light waves reach the cells, they're absorbed by components called chromophores, such as cytochrome c oxidase in mitochondria. This absorption causes a series of biological feedbacks, including boosted mobile power manufacturing and the release of nitric oxide, which enhances blood circulation and decreases inflammation.

Devices of Action
Exactly how does cold laser therapy in fact function to produce its healing impacts on organic tissues?
Cold laser therapy, also known as low-level laser therapy (LLLT), runs with a process known as photobiomodulation. When just click the following webpage is applied to the skin, the light power permeates the tissues and is absorbed by chromophores within the cells.
These chromophores, such as cytochrome c oxidase in the mitochondria, are after that boosted by the light energy, resulting in a waterfall of biological reactions. One essential system of action is the enhancement of mobile metabolic process.
The soaked up light energy enhances ATP production in the mitochondria, which is important for mobile feature and repair service. Furthermore, cold laser treatment assists to lower swelling by hindering inflammatory conciliators and promoting the release of anti-inflammatory cytokines.
This anti-inflammatory impact contributes to pain alleviation and cells healing.
